Amputated Mariana Bridi da Costa Dies

Feet and hands amputated to save her life from the drug-resistant bacteria, Mariana Bridi da Costa died last Saturday.


Despite efforts of Brazilian doctors to spare the already amputated body of the young model from the drug-resistant bacteria, Bridi's body no longer reacted to the potent drugs pumped into her to stop the spread of infection. The bacteria in her veins have spread from her head to her toes. By Saturday, she was already dead from the infection caused by Pseudomonas aeruginosa.

Pseudomonas aeruginosa is an extremely drug-resistant bacteria. While it is described to have “low antibiotic susceptibility,” it also easily mutates to develop resistance to new drugs. Just imagine how quickly the bacteria have spread into Bridi's body – she was misdiagnosed with kidney stones on late December but when she returned back to the hospital on January 3 for the seemingly ordinary urinary tract infection, she was already on “life-threatening low blood pressure.” The bacteria caused her to lose her feet and hands, and eventually her life.

What a pity! At 20, Mariana Bridi da Costa had a promising modeling career. She was one of the many Hispanic women who use their phenomenal beauty to alleviate their family from poverty. Born to a taxi driver father and a house cleaner mother, Bridi started modeling at the age of 14. When she turned 18, she earned the right of being a beauty queen as she became a finalist to the Brazilian Miss World pageant. She had also won international bikini competitions. Last year, she ranked fourth in the Face of the Universe competition in South Africa. She was to participate next month in the second stage of a modeling competition held in Sao Paulo by Brazilian model scout Dilson Stein, the one who discovered supermodel Gisele Bundchen.

Mariana Bridi da Costa's funeral was at the town of Marechal Floriano. With the early death of the model and beauty queen, the only consolation that her family had cling on to was the fact that she did not suffer long from her illness. “God is comforting our hearts because he wanted her to be with him now,” her father had said. Outside the hospital where she died, Bridi's aunt also told reporters “I believe that the serenity on her face came from this spiritual comfort.”

66th Annual Golden Globe Awards 2009

Thanks to the glamorous stars (as well as Hollywood worst dressers), the 66th Golden Globe Awards, handed out annually by the Hollywood Foreign Press Association (HFPA) successfully commanded wide public attention for motion pictures and television like it did in the past.

Winners for the 66th Annual Golden Globe Awards 2009 received their awards last January 11, 2009 at the Beverly Hilton Hotel.

Here's this year's list of Golden Globe Awards winners:

MOTION PICTURES:
Picture, Drama: "Slumdog Millionaire."
Picture, Musical or Comedy: "Vicky Christina Barcelona."
Actor, Drama: Mickey Rourke, "The Wrestler."
Actress, Drama: Kate Winslet, "Revolutionary Road."
Director: Danny Boyle, "Slumdog Millionaire."
Actor, Musical or Comedy: Colin Farrell, "In Bruges."
Actress, Musical or Comedy: Sally Hawkins, "Happy-Go-Lucky."
Supporting Actor: Heath Ledger, "The Dark Knight."
Supporting Actress: Kate Winslet, "The Reader."
Foreign Language Film: "Waltz With Bashir."
Animated Film: "Wall-E."
Screenplay: Simon Beaufoy, "Slumdog Millionaire."
Original Score: A.R. Rahman, "Slumdog Millionaire."
Original Song: "The Wrestler" (performed by Bruce Springsteen, written by Bruce Springsteen), "The Wrestler."


TELEVISION:
Series, Drama: "Mad Men."
Actor, Drama: Gabriel Byrne, "In Treatment."
Actress, Drama: Anna Paquin, "True Blood."
Series, Musical or Comedy: "30 Rock."
Actor, Musical or Comedy: Alec Baldwin, "30 Rock."
Actress, Musical or Comedy: Tina Fey, "30 Rock."
Miniseries or Movie: "John Adams."
Actress, Miniseries or Movie: Laura Linney, "John Adams."
Actor, Miniseries or Movie: Paul Giammatti, "John Adams."
Supporting Actress, Series, Miniseries or Movie: Laura Dern, "Recount."
Supporting Actor, Series, Miniseries or Movie: Tom Wilkinson, "John Adams."

The End Of The Hourglass Woman

Women's stressful careers today might just put an end to the classic hourglass figure.


Made popular by voluptuous Marilyn Monroe, the hourglass figure is the woman's curvy shape of tiny waist, wide hips, and big boobs. According to studies, women who possess the classic hourglass figure (usually those with a waist-to-hip ratio of 0.7, where the waist circumference is 70 percent of the hips or lower) have higher fertility rates and less chance of chronic disease.

However, experts suggest that the hourglass figure among women are dying out, and this they blamed to career-oriented women with demanding and stressful jobs. “Women who work release more hormones that help them become physically stronger, so they can deal with the stress of high-powered jobs,” says researcher Elizabeth Cashdan. As a result, women develop fewer curves, small boobs, and no hips – more like the slim figure of Madonna.

But how do women see the end of the hourglass figure? According to researchers, the demanding nature of the jobs carried out by today's high-powered women has, in fact, influence them to prefer a leaner physique, “with weight around the middle rather than the hips.”

To prove the study right, Elizabeth Cashdan and her fellow researchers traveled to 37 countries to measure the waist-to-hip ratio.

The conclusion:
"Waist-to-hip ratio may be a useful signal to men... but whether men prefer it should depend on the degree to which they want their mates to be strong, tough, economically successful and politically competitive."

"And from a woman's perspective, men's preferences are not the only thing that matters. This is about trade-offs. The human body is a compromise," she added.

Poor Teenage Girl Rises To Become A Top Model

This time Cinderella is a fashion model.


A poor teenage girl who grew up sifting through garbage bins and selling cardboard on the dirty streets of Buenos Aires rises to become a top model for the world's biggest modeling agency, Elite.

The lovely but poverty-stricken Daniela Cott, 16, was spotted two years ago by necklace designer Marina Gonzalez sifting bins in the streets of Buenos Aires, Argentina.

With the typical model height of 5 feet 10 inches tall, and a pair of emerald green eyes, the designer noticed the youngster's natural beauty through her rags and tangled hair and told her, “You should be a model.”

Alas! It was the magic word that started the glamorous transformation of the young Daniela. Her pictures was sent to an Elite agent who eventually called her in for an interview. She then joined the Argentina4s Elite Model Look competition and win the crown from 1,000 other models. It was the same competition that have launched the careers of Cindy Crawford and Gisele Bundchen.

The competition officially signed her up for Elite. And when she received her first pay cheque from a modeling job in 2006, she treated the nine members of her family to an “eat you can” restaurant buffet.

Who would have thought that the dirty teenage girl who merely lived with her family among 10,000 “cartoneros” in Buenos Aires to sift through bins and households for cardboard and used cans and bottles would become a fashion model? Not even Daniela herself.

“I never imagined in my wildest dreams that I would one day become a model. I started working as a cartonera when I was 13 because my family had no other choice. I worked every day after school from 6pm to 10pm. Between me and all my family we earned around 50 pounds a week. The work was very tough, and I did it every day for 18 months. We went through people's rubbish looking for cardboard, newspapers or glass bottles to sell to the recycling plant for a few pence. It was a dirty job, and I didn't like it, but I did it to help my family. After working at night, every morning I had to get up for school. One day when I was working I met a woman called Marina, who told me 'You're so beautiful, you should be a model.' She persuaded me to pose for some photographs, and sent them off to an agent. Everything took off from there.”

But modeling did not also come naturally for the Latina beauty. When she was entered into the modeling competition, she could not walk on high heels and had to spend six months mastering the catwalk ramp. Her rough hands also had to undergo lengthy treatment to remove the calluses, cuts, and scars.

Looking back, Daniela proudly shared, “When they entered me into the Elite competition I thought there was no way I could win it. I burst into tears when I won. It was the greatest moment of my life. Now my career is starting to take off. I love posing for photographs and being on the catwalk. I have traveled to Europe, working in Paris, Milan and Madrid, something I never, ever dreamed would be possible.”

Like any triumphant Cinderellas, the lovely Daniela now has her humanitarian aspirations: “Now I want to use my career to highlight the problems of the cartoneros living in Buenos Aires. Working as a cartonera helped me, because it gave me a strong character and a determination, and taught me never to be afraid of anything.”


And as to the challenges of modeling, the once poor teenage girl who rises to the top of the modeling world and now lives the glamorous life of fashion modeling has this realization:

“I was lucky enough to be in the right place at the right time. The modeling work hasn't been easy. I used to say that modeling on a catwalk or posing for photographs couldn't be very difficult. Now I realize it is difficult, but not as hard as collecting rubbish.”
